At the bridge: prompt, issue the dir flash: command in order to view a directory of the Flash file
system.
The directory is similar to this directory:
bridge: dir flash:
Directory of flash:/
2 −rwx 0 <date> env_vars
5 drwx 384 <date> C1310−k9w7−mx.v133_15_JA.20040314
3 −rwx 1128 <date> config.txt
4 −rwx 5 <date> private−config
3693568 bytes available (4047872 bytes used)
bridge:
4.
Delete or rename the files config.txt and env_vars, and reboot the bridge.
Note: Do not forget the / character before the filenames.
bridge: delete flash:config.txt
Are you sure you want to delete flash:/config.txt (y/n)?y
File "flash:/config.txt" deleted
bridge: delete flash:/env_vars
Are you sure you want to delete "flash:/env_vars" (y/n)?y
File "flash:/env_vars" deleted
5.
Issue the boot command in order to reboot the bridge at the bridge: prompt, or simply power cycle
the bridge.
6.
After the bridge reboots, reconfigure the bridge with the web browser interface, the Telnet interface,
or Cisco IOS Software commands.
Note: The AP is configured with the factory default values that include:
The IP address, which is set to receive an IP address with DHCP♦
The default username and password, "Cisco"♦
